Understanding Smartwatch Battery Drain: Common Causes
Before adjusting settings, it helps to understand what consumes power on a smartwatch. Unlike smartphones, smartwatches have smaller batteries but run similar operating systems with continuous connectivity, sensors, and displays. Key culprits behind fast battery drain include:
- Bright or always-on displays: OLED screens consume more energy when showing bright whites and active pixels.
- Background apps and third-party widgets: Apps running in the background, especially those syncing frequently, drain resources.
- GPS and heart rate monitoring: Continuous sensor use, particularly GPS during workouts, significantly impacts battery.
- Frequent notifications: Every buzz, beep, or screen wake uses power—even if briefly.
- Wi-Fi, Bluetooth, and LTE: Constant connectivity, especially on LTE models, keeps radios active and increases consumption.
- Software bugs or outdated firmware: Glitches in apps or OS updates can cause abnormal power draw.

Essential Settings to Change for Better Battery Life
Adjusting your smartwatch settings doesn’t mean giving up all its benefits. It’s about optimizing for efficiency. Here are the most impactful changes you can make today.
1. Adjust Display Brightness and Timeout
The display is one of the biggest power consumers. Reducing brightness and shortening how long the screen stays on after interaction makes a noticeable difference.
- Go to Settings > Display.
- Set brightness to 40–60% (or enable auto-brightness).
- Reduce screen timeout to 7–10 seconds.
- Turn off “Always-On” display unless absolutely necessary.
If your watch supports adaptive brightness, use it. It automatically dims indoors and brightens in sunlight, balancing visibility and efficiency.
2. Limit Background App Refresh and Widgets
Third-party apps often refresh data every few minutes—checking weather, social media, or email. Each refresh wakes the processor and uses battery.
- Remove unnecessary widgets from your watch face.
- Disable background refresh for non-essential apps via companion phone app.
- Delete apps you rarely use—each installed app may still run background services.
3. Optimize Health and Fitness Tracking
While fitness tracking is a primary reason people buy smartwatches, continuous monitoring adds strain. You can customize these features without losing value.
| Feature | Power Impact | Optimization Tip |
|---|---|---|
| Heart Rate Monitoring | High | Switch to “On Demand” or “Every 10 min” instead of continuous. |
| SpO2 (Blood Oxygen) | Medium-High | Disable automatic nightly tracking unless medically needed. |
| GPS During Workouts | Very High | Use GPS only for outdoor runs/cycles; rely on phone GPS when possible. |
| Sleep Tracking | Medium | Keep enabled, but disable additional metrics like body temperature unless used. |

4. Manage Notifications Intelligently
Every notification triggers haptic feedback, screen wake, and sound—all of which add up. Be selective.
- Only allow critical apps (calls, messages, calendar) to notify your wrist.
- Disable vibrations for non-urgent alerts.
- Use “Do Not Disturb” during sleep or focused work hours.
5. Turn Off Unnecessary Connectivity
LTE, Wi-Fi, and Bluetooth are convenient—but keeping them always active costs battery.
- LTE: Disable if you’re usually near your phone. Use only when leaving your phone behind.
- Wi-Fi: Turn off if not syncing large files or streaming music directly.
- Bluetooth: Cannot be fully disabled (needed for phone connection), but ensure no extra devices are paired.
Step-by-Step Guide: Reset and Optimize Your Smartwatch
If your battery drain started suddenly, follow this optimization routine to reset and fine-tune performance.
- Restart your smartwatch. A simple reboot clears temporary glitches and stops rogue processes.
- Update software. Go to Settings > System > Software Update. Install any pending updates—many fix battery-related bugs.
- Review battery usage stats. Navigate to Settings > Battery > Usage. Identify which apps or features are consuming the most power.
- Uninstall unused apps. Remove anything you haven’t opened in the last two weeks.
- Reset settings (optional). If problems persist, consider resetting to factory defaults after backing up data. This clears corrupted preferences.
- Reconfigure optimized settings. Apply the changes outlined above: dimmer screen, limited notifications, reduced sensor frequency.
This process typically takes less than 20 minutes and can restore normal battery behavior in most cases.

Why does my smartwatch battery drain overnight?
Nighttime drain is often caused by background syncing, sleep tracking with SpO2/GPS, or apps refreshing data. Check battery usage logs to see if a specific app is active. Also, ensure your phone isn’t pushing large sync jobs (like photos) while you sleep.
Is it bad to charge my smartwatch every night?
No. Modern smartwatches use lithium-ion batteries with built-in safeguards. Charging nightly is safe and recommended. However, avoid letting the battery drop below 10% regularly, as deep discharges can shorten lifespan over time.
Does turning off Bluetooth save battery on my smartwatch?
Not significantly—and it defeats the purpose. Turning off Bluetooth disconnects your watch from your phone, disabling calls, messages, and app sync. Instead, keep Bluetooth on but manage what data gets pushed to your wrist.
